What companies run services between Echuca, VIC, Australia and Adelaide, SA, Australia?

V-Line Buses operates a bus from Echuca Station/Sturt St to 85 Franklin St once daily. Tickets cost $9–50 and the journey takes 10h 55m. Alternatively, you can take a train from Echuca Station to Adelaide Station via Southern Cross Station in around 14h 42m.
